WHAT IS FILM PRIZE JUNIOR?
Inspired by Louisiana Film Prize, Film Prize Junior is a student short film competition for middle and high school students across the state of Louisiana. For this competition, educators and students work together to create a concept, write a story, and produce and edit a short film with help from our team members and film mentors. If an entrant to our festival makes it through our competition, we showcase their short film at our film festival. Furthermore, entries can qualify for huge prizes including equipment grants for the schools, scholarships for the students and cash rewards for the educators!

HOW TO PARTICIPATE IN FILM PRIZE JUNIOR
To participate in Film Prize Junior, you only need three things: a Teacher Sponsor from a school or program in the state of Louisiana, a Student Lead enrolled in middle school or high school, and a Film Concept to bring to the big screen at our festival. The Film Prize Junior team keeps in touch with filmmakers throughout the process to provide students and educators with reminders, resources and training every step of the way. No matter what education or resources are available at your school, Film Prize Junior will be there for guidance and support.
